Weedsport will apply for the next round of NY Forward Funding.
The Cayuga County Planning & Economic Development Department is assisting the village in this endeavor. Javier Zavaleta is a planner with the department who is helping the village complete the necessary steps and create the application to send to the state by the end of September.
Zavelata told Finger Lakes News Radio that they are currently seeking projects to consider for the application.
“We encourage stakeholders, business owners, and any property owner that has a project that fits within the eligible activities to fill out that form and then we guide them from that point on,” Zavelata said.
He added that projects should assist in revitalizing the village’s downtown such as rehabilitating a dilapidated building or expanding business operations through building upgrades or equipment purchases.
“[We’re] trying to provide the most compelling list of projects so we can have the most compelling application,” he continued.

A public workshop will take place May 23 at 6:00p at the village offices to discuss potential projects.
New for this year, applicants need to be pro-housing communities. The village has sent a letter of intent to become a pro-housing community to the state.
Launched last year, the NY Forward program is designed to revitalize downtowns in communities typically too small for DRI funding.
If selected as a recipient, a second call for projects will be put out with a local planning committee being formed to select which ones should receive funding. This process is the same as the process currently underway in the Villages of Aurora, Cayuga, and Union Springs for their $10 million DRI award.
The Villages of Moravia in Cayuga County, Phoenix in Oswego County, and Hamilton in Madison County won the inaugural NY Forward awards for the Central New York region.
